Sawyer Wurdock, a Greene Early College junior, recently received the rank of Eagle Scout, the highest achievement in the Scouting world. Attended by family, friends and fellow scouts, the official ceremony was held Saturday, April 10, at Hull Road Free Will Baptist Church.

A new, in depth economic impact analysis found North Carolina’s 58 Community Colleges have a $19 billion annual impact on the state’s economy - supporting more than 320,000 jobs or one out of every 19 jobs across the state.

On Tuesday, April 12, all eleven volunteer fire departments will conduct a training water haul and tanker fill operation. The event will be held on Beaman Old Creek Rd. and the hydrant closest to Hwy 91 N will be utilized. Residents may notice some discolored water briefly. We apologize for the inconvenience.
